JOB SUMMARY


In this role, you'll spearhead our commitment to delivering safe, high-quality food products, relying on your analytical expertise to achieve this mission.

Your responsibilities include safeguarding product quality and safety through meticulous customer data analysis across our 15 NA manufacturing plants.

Your insights and recommendations will guide data-centric decisions to elevate our food safety and quality standards, ensure protection, and uphold our esteemed reputation for excellence.


Objectives:


  • Develop, implement, and maintain cuttingedge analytical systems, streamlining complex issues.
  • Identify growth opportunities within intricate data sets for organizational advancement.
  • Assess existing methodologies and provide data documentation.
  • Create datadriven reports through mining, analysis, and visualization.
  • Evaluate internal systems for efficiency and anomalies while establishing data handling protocols.
  • Foster collaborative relationships with management and users.

Key Responsibilities:


  • Analyze customer data for safety and health concerns, encompassing complaints, feedback, and incident reports.
  • Identify trends and patterns affecting food safety and customer health.
  • Prioritize and address potential safety and health risks through risk assessments.
  • Collaborate with crossfunctional teams to develop risk mitigation strategies.
  • Improve product quality, manufacturing processes, and safety protocols closely with quality assurance teams.
  • Ensure compliance with food safety regulations and industry standards through recommendations.
  • Convey insights and recommendations via regular reports and presentations to management and stakeholders.
  • Share information and best practices regarding food safety and health with internal and external partners.
  • Stay current with relevant food safety regulations and industry standards.
  • Manage a secure data repository for customer health and safety data, implementing data management best practices to maintain data accuracy and integrity.
  • Correlate trends in internal audits to external audits and, with the help of factory stakeholders, build action plans.
  • Correlate trends of multiple data streams (ex., Audits, FTQ, sensory results, complaints), find trends and help make datadriven decisions.
  • Support Consumer/customer quality with GCS data entry, Portal management along with customer complaint follow up.
